Daylight Solutions Wins 2009 National Prism Award for Innovation

01.28.09

Daylight Solutions is pleased to announce that on Wednesday, January 28, 2009, the company was presented with a 2008 Prism Award. The Prism Awards recognize the best in innovative technology within the multi-billion dollar photonics industry. Daylight Solutions received a Prism Award in the Laser category for its broadly tunable, CW Mode Hop Free laser system. The awards banquet and ceremony was held at the Fairmont Hotel in San Jose, California, in conjunction with the SPIE Photonics West 2009 conference and exhibition, the largest event of its kind in the field.

The eleven 2008 Prism award winners were narrowed from a pool of 130 applicants and 74 finalists. The ten award categories included optics; lasers; other light sources; detectors, sensing & imagining systems; analytical, test & measurement; photonics systems; photonics processes; sustainable/green technology; life sciences; and overall winner (best in show). The distinguished panel of 28 judges, recognized experts in their various fields, represented multiple disciplines and countries, including the USA, UK, Poland, Germany, Japan, Singapore, Ireland, and China.

This is not the first time Daylight Solutions has been recognized for its pioneering technology. The company’s broadly tunable ECqcLs won the Photonics Applications System Technologies (PhAST) 2006 Innovation award. This award honored the most timely, ground-breaking products in the field of laser science. The company continues to lead in innovation, and currently manufactures the world’s leading miniaturized, mid-infrared tunable and fixed wavelength lasers. Applications of this technology include industrial process controls, cellular imaging, molecular detection, and detection of chemical and biological agents.
